What is Sea Harvest Group Total Liabilities?

Sea Harvest Group's Total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was R5,964 Mil.

Sea Harvest Group's quarterly Total Liabilities declined from Jun. 2023 (R4,810.71 Mil) to Dec. 2023 (R4,647.13 Mil) but then increased from Dec. 2023 (R4,647.13 Mil) to Jun. 2024 (R5,964.31 Mil).

Sea Harvest Group's annual Total Liabilities increased from Dec. 2021 (R3,669.46 Mil) to Dec. 2022 (R4,401.16 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2022 (R4,401.16 Mil) to Dec. 2023 (R4,647.13 Mil).

Sea Harvest Group Total Liabilities Calculation

Total Liabilities are the liabilities that the company has to pay others. It is a part of the balance sheet of a company that shareholders do not own, and would be obligated to pay back if the company liquidated.

Sea Harvest Group's Total Liabilities for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Total Liabilities=Total Current Liabilities+Total Noncurrent Liabilities
=Total Current Liabilities+(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ation+Other Long-Term Liabilities
=1253.432+(2478.932+884.978
+NonCurrent Deferred Liabilities+PensionAndRetirementBenefit)
+0+29.791)
=4,647

Total Liabilities=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)-Total Equity (A: Dec. 2023 )
=8024.545-3377.412
=4,647

Sea Harvest Group Ltd is engaged in the fishing of Cape Hake and Shark Bay Prawns along with Horse Mackerel, Pilchards, Anchovies, and a variety of farmed species, processing of the catch into frozen and chilled seafood, and the marketing of these products, locally and internationally. It operates in four segments: South African Fishing, Australian operation, Aquaculture, and Cape Harvest Foods segments." The majority of its revenue comes from the South African Fishing segment.
